Harnessing the Web with XPath: Powerful Queries for Data Acquisition

XPath stands as a versatile querying language, enabling developers to precisely explore the vast landscape of the web. Its detailed syntax empowers users to isolate specific elements within HTML Parsing HTML documents, effectively retrieving valuable data.

If you're scraping product information, analyzing web content, or simply interacting dynamic web pages, XPath offers a powerful solution for your data needs.

With its ability to select elements based on their attributes, tags, and relationships, XPath opens up a world of possibilities for developers seeking to utilize the full potential of web data.

Building Intelligent Applications: The Power of Web Scraping and Data Mining

In today's data-driven world, building intelligent applications relies heavily on the efficient extraction and analysis of information. Web scraping and data mining have emerged as powerful tools for this purpose, enabling developers to harvest vast quantities of data from the web and modify it into valuable insights.

Web scraping involves automatically retrieving content from websites, while data mining focuses on discovering patterns and relationships within organized datasets. By combining these techniques, developers can construct applications that offer a wide range of functionalities, such as tailored recommendations, predictive analytics, and instantaneous market tracking.

Furthermore, web scraping and data mining can be used to streamline various business processes, boosting efficiency and productivity. For example, companies can use these techniques to track competitor activity, recognize popular products and services, and acquire a deeper understanding of customer behavior.
